Market Valuation and Segment Context

The global market for Wood Bedroom Furniture for Teens was estimated to be worth US$ 93,600 million in 2025 and is projected to reach US$ 122,700 million, growing at a CAGR of 4.0% from 2026 to 2032. This substantial market size is best contextualized within adjacent youth furniture segments: QYResearch data indicates the global youth bedroom furniture market reached approximately $90.0 billion in 2024 and is projected to reach $118.4 billion by 2031 at a 4.0% CAGR, confirming the teen bedroom furniture segment’s central position within the broader category.

Wood bedroom furniture for teens refers to a durable and functional category of furnishings designed specifically to meet the needs, style, and evolving preferences of adolescents (typically ages 13 to 19). This furniture is characterized by its use of solid wood or engineered wood materials (such as MDF or plywood with wood veneer) for long-lasting construction. Key pieces often include twin, full, or queen-sized beds, study desks, chairs, chests of drawers (dressers), and wardrobes. The design typically balances modern aesthetics with practical features like integrated storage solutions, built-in charging stations, and flexible configurations to accommodate both academic work and personal leisure in confined bedroom spaces.

Product Design Evolution: Technology Integration and Space Optimization

A defining characteristic of contemporary teen bedroom furniture is the seamless integration of technology and space-saving design principles. Industry analysis reveals that premium youth bedroom furniture collections increasingly incorporate built-in USB charging ports, wireless charging pads, integrated LED lighting, and concealed cable management systems—features that acknowledge the digitally native lifestyle of adolescent users. Rooms To Go Kids’ Cloud9 collection exemplifies this trend with nightstands featuring glow-in-the-dark cup holders, wireless charging docks, USB ports, and concealed storage compartments alongside bookcases incorporating touch LED reading lights and swivel work tables.

The modular furniture design trend is equally pronounced, with manufacturers developing systems that can be reconfigured as adolescent needs evolve. IKEA’s BOLLPOJKE desk system demonstrates this approach: solid pine tops support creative pursuits from crafting to gaming, with hidden under-desk storage and the flexibility to push multiple desks together for collaborative workspaces. This adaptability addresses the multi-functional demands of adolescent living spaces where a single room must accommodate sleeping, studying, socializing, and self-expression.

Space-Saving Design Imperatives for Compact Urban Living

The global trend toward urban densification has elevated space-saving design from desirable feature to essential requirement in teen bedroom furniture. Interior design professionals specializing in compact teen rooms emphasize multi-functional solutions: loft beds that free floor area for lounge or study zones, wall-mounted flip-down desks that disappear when not in use, and vertical storage walls that maximize limited square footage. Research indicates that visual clutter reduction through integrated storage improves concentration—a critical consideration for ergonomic study furniture deployed in adolescent living spaces where academic performance and personal organization intersect.

The HOMES Group’s Mistral UP collection exemplifies the modular furniture design approach to space-saving design, integrating bed, desk, wardrobe, and drawer storage into a unified system that adapts from childhood through adolescence, addressing the “grow-with-me” functionality increasingly demanded by parents making long-term furniture investments.

Sustainable Wood Materials and Manufacturing Considerations

The upstream supply chain for teen bedroom furniture encompasses raw material suppliers providing solid hardwoods (oak, maple, birch), engineered wood products (MDF, particleboard, plywood with wood veneers), adhesives, finishes, and hardware components. A critical development reshaping material selection is growing consumer and regulatory emphasis on sustainable wood materials including FSC-certified timber, low-formaldehyde engineered boards, and water-based finishes that reduce volatile organic compound (VOC) emissions. Manufacturers serving environmentally conscious markets are increasingly documenting supply chain traceability and material certifications as competitive differentiators.

From a manufacturing perspective, youth bedroom furniture production encompasses both discrete manufacturing of individual furniture pieces and process manufacturing of engineered wood substrates. Quality assurance protocols mandate verification of structural integrity under dynamic loading conditions (particularly for loft and bunk bed configurations), finish durability against adolescent wear patterns, and compliance with safety standards including tip-over prevention requirements and chemical emissions limits.

Industry Segmentation: Household vs. Commercial Applications

A granular, industry-layered perspective reveals distinct product specifications and purchasing criteria across teen bedroom furniture applications. The household segment dominates volume, driven by parents and guardians outfitting individual adolescent living spaces. Purchasing decisions in this segment prioritize aesthetic alignment with evolving teen preferences, space-saving design features for typically modest bedroom dimensions, and ergonomic study furniture attributes that support academic success.

The commercial segment—encompassing student housing operators, educational institutions, and hospitality providers—imposes fundamentally different requirements. Procurement in this segment prioritizes modular furniture design enabling efficient room reconfiguration, sustainable wood materials credentials supporting institutional sustainability commitments, and verified durability capable of withstanding multi-year occupancy cycles with minimal replacement frequency. Exclusive analysis of institutional procurement patterns indicates that leading teen bedroom furniture suppliers are developing commercial-grade product lines with enhanced warranty coverage and simplified maintenance protocols tailored to high-turnover student accommodation environments.
